How A Security Camera Works


Article Written By: catwomanseven

Add Your Picture The thing that people tend to forget about a security camera is that they aren't just for taping crime, but also about preventing it. You see, people have the wrong ideas about security cameras. They think that they merely tape crime and misbehavior. While that is true and they are great for making sure you get a positive identification if something were to go wrong at your home or business, when it comes down to it it is much more likely that the cameras will actually be used as a deterrent much more often then they will be used to catch any sort of crime.

The reason for this is simple human nature: the more you feel like you are being watched, the more you are going to be on your best behavior. For proof of this, all you have to do is think of your own behavior. Now, I will assume that you aren't walking into a shop to steal anything, that's not the point, I'm talking about pure human nature. The thing is, even if you are just walking into a shop to buy a soda or a DVD your behavior will change, even slightly, if you notice that you are being watched by a security camera.

Even if you weren't planning on doing anything wrong (which you weren't, I'm sure), you are going to behave slightly differently if you know you are being watched. It's the same idea as when you were a kid and a teacher walked by your desk during a test: even if you weren't cheating you felt different now that you were being watched. Now imagine how you would feel if you were planning on doing something wrong like stealing products, property or money? When someone goes to rob or a home or business, they want to get in, get what they wanted and get out without being identified, or, better yet, seen.

The average person who witnesses a crime is going to be so shaken that their memory won't be good enough to actually identify someone. A security camera, on the other hand, will record everything. Chances are if a potential criminal sees a security camera he (or she) will just move on to the next target. Unless they are really desperate, they will turn their focus to someplace where they won't run the risk of being identified.
